PS2506-4 Information

PS2506-4 by NEC Electronics Group is an Optocoupler.
Optocoupler are under the broader part category of Optoelectronics.

Optoelectronic components work to detect, generate, and control light. They can essentially produce and/or react to light. Read more about Optoelectronics on our Optoelectronics part category page.

PS2506-4 Part Data Attributes

PS2506-4 NEC Electronics Group
Buy Now Datasheet
Compare Parts:
PS2506-4 NEC Electronics Group AC Input-Darlington Output Optocoupler, 4-Element, 5000V Isolation, PLASTIC, DIP-16
Select a part to compare:
Rohs Code No
Part Life Cycle Code Obsolete
Ihs Manufacturer NEC ELECTRONICS CORP
Package Description PLASTIC, DIP-16
Reach Compliance Code compliant
HTS Code 8541.40.80.00
Additional Feature UL RECOGNIZED
Coll-Emtr Bkdn Voltage-Min 40 V
Configuration SEPARATE, 4 CHANNELS
Current Transfer Ratio-Nom 2000%
Dark Current-Max 400 nA
Forward Current-Max 0.08 A
Isolation Voltage-Max 5000 V
Number of Elements 4
Operating Temperature-Max 100 °C
Operating Temperature-Min -55 °C
Optoelectronic Device Type AC INPUT-DARLINGTON OUTPUT OPTOCOUPLER
